Jacinda Morigeau is running for Montana State Senator, District 46.

Personal background

Jacinda received a Bachelor of Arts in psychology from the University of Montana. She is vice-chairperson of the All Nations Health Center Board of Directors. She is Bitterroot Salish and an enrolled Confederated Salish and Kootenai Tribal citizen from Arlee.

Professional background

Jacinda is the communications manager at United Way of Missoula County.

Political background

Jacinda Morigeau's campaign for State Senator for Montana District 46 is her first entry into politics.

Economy

Advocates for an increased housing supply, "fair and accessible" housing options, and cutting property taxes to make housing affordable.

Healthcare

Plans to protect access to healthcare by renewing the Montana Medicaid program.

Supports access to abortion and IVF (in vitro fertilization) treatments.

Education

Advocates for "fully funded public K-12 schools and increased support for teachers."

Advocates for promoting higher education through scholarships and student loan forgiveness programs.

Aims to "address childcare needs."

Energy & the Environment

Plans to support conservation efforts with "traditional ecological knowledge."

Wants to collaborate with sovereign tribal nations to preserve the environment.
